Haut-Ogooué ( German Oberogooué ) is a province of Gabon with the capital Franceville .
geography
The province is located in the east of the country and borders the province of Ogooué-Ivindo in the north, the Republic of Congo in the south and east and the province of Ogooué-Lolo in the west .
Haut-Ogooué is divided into the departments of Djoue , Djououri-Aguilli , Lekoni-Lekori , Lekoko , Lemboumbi-Leyou , Mpassa , Plateaux , Sebe-Brikolo , Ogooué-Létili , Lékabi-Léwolo and Bayi-Brikolo .
